The
Electronic Vis-U-Tec senses pressure differentials as low as 10 psig (0.69
barg) downstream from the Rupture Disk (Bursting Disc). Vis-U-Tec's piston fully extends,
breaking the sensor's conductive circuit. Used with the Burst Disk
Monitor, Vis-U-Tec's electrical warning triggers an audible or visual
alarm.

Features
After
replacing the ruptured disk, reset the Vis-U-Tec by pushing the piston
fully back into the unit.
12
inch (30cm) two-conductor cable
316
SS construction for all wetted parts contacting process fluids
Viton
O-ring seals the piston.
Operating temperatures range from - 40 °F (- 40 °C) to 400 °F
(204 °C).
Maximum current: 250 mA
Maximum voltage: 24 Vdc
Suitable for intrinsically safe applications when used with
certified apparatus (i.e. Zener Barrier)
Available with Aluminum Piston option that provides visual
warning only.
Installation
The
Vis-U-Tec sensor fits into the Safety Head or piping outlet using a _ inch
NPT screw connection.
Availability
Use the
Vis-U-Tec sensor in applications that vent into enclosed volumes or for
free-venting applications.
